NGC 891 (Herschel 36)

NGC 891 (Herschel 36) is a galaxy located in the constellation Andromeda. NGC 891 is best viewed during Fall, is magnitude 10, and can be viewed with small telescope.

NGC 891 is also listed in the Caldwell Catalog as C23.
